Welcome to National Signing Day! It's like Christmas in February for us recruitniks, as we wait to see who will finalize the Ohio State class of 2011 recruiting class. There are sure to be some surprises and wild news today, so continue to come back to 11W throughout the day to check out the latest news on who's going where, as well as the chart below the jump to see whose letters of intent have rolled in for the Buckeyes already.
| Player | Pos | Ht/Wt | Hometown (High School) | Position Rank |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Nick Vannet | TE | 6-6/230 | Westerville, OH (Westerville Central) | Scout #14, Rivals #13, ESPN #7 |
| Bryce Haynes | LS | 6-4/185 | Cumming, GA (Pinecrest Academy) | #1 across the board |
| Chase Farris | DL/OL | 6-6/265 | Elyria, OH (Elyria) | Scout DT#10, Rivals DE#11, ESPN DE#28 |
| Antonio Underwood | OG | 6-3/295 | Shaker Heights, OH (Shaker Heights) | Scout OG#22, Rivals NR, ESPN OG#75 |
| Jeremy Cash | S | 6-2/185 | Plantation, FL (Plantation) | Scout S#30, Rivals S#25, ESPN S#13 |
| Joel Hale | DL | 6-4/290 | Greenwood, IN (Center Grove) | Scout DT#30, Rivals DT#35, ESPN DT#30 |
| Braxton Miller | QB | 6-2/190 | Huber Heights, OH (Wayne) | Scout QB#2, Rivals QB#1, ESPN QB#4 |
| Ryan Shazier | LB | 6-3/210 | Plantation, FL (Plantation) | Scout OLB#5, Rivals OLB#14, ESPN OLB#4 |
| Jeff Heuerman | TE | 6-5/240 | Naples, FL (Barron Collier) | Scout TE#24, Rivals TE#18, ESPN TE#6 |
| Conner Crowell | LB | 6-1/215 | Waldorf, MD (North Point) | Scout MLB#24, Rivals OLB#24, ESPN OLB#69 |
| Ejuan Price | LB | 6-0/235 | Pittsburgh, PA (Woodland Hills) | Scout MLB#14, Rivals ILB NR, ESPN ILB#12 |
| Tommy Brown | OT | 6-5/310 | Akron, OH (Firestone Senior) | Scout OT#83, Rivals OT#42, ESPN OT# 38 |
| Doran Grant | CB | 5-10/175 | Akron, OH (St. Vincent-St. Mary) | Scout CB#5, Rivals CB#7, ESPN CB#3 |
| Evan Spencer | WR | 6-1/185 | Vernon Hills, IL (Vernon Hills) | Scout WR#19, Rivals WR#51, ESPN WR#18 |
| Steve Miller | DE | 6-4/230 | Canton, OH (McKinley) | Scout DE#9, Rivals DE#7, ESPN DE#6 |
| Brian Bobek | C | 6-3/280 | Palatine, IL (Fremd) | Scout C#1, Rivals C#3, ESPN C#3 |
| Michael Bennett | DT | 6-3/275 | Centerville, OH (Centerville) | Scout DT#8, Rivals DT#3, ESPN OG#7 |
| Ron Tanner | S | 6-1/190 | Columbus, OH (Eastmoor) | Scout S#11, Rivals S#26, ESPN S#33 |
| Kenny Hayes | DE | 6-5/240 | Toledo, OH (Whitmer) | Scout DE#14, Rivals DE#7, ESPN DE#27 |
| Devin Smith | WR | 6-1/175 | Massillon, OH (Washington) | Scout WR#29, Rivals WR#58, ESPN WR#55 |
| DerJuan Gambrell | CB | 6-2/180 | Toledo, OH (Rogers) | Scout CB#22, Rivals CB#35, ESPN CB#55 |
| Curtis Grant | LB | 6-3/220 | Richmond, VA (Hermitage) | Scout OLB#1, Rivals ILB#1, ESPN ILB#3 |
- As Chris mentioned in the comments, Cardale Jones has committed to Ohio State as well. He will be coming to Columbus after spending 6 months at prep school and will enroll in Winter or Spring quarter of 2012
- Ja'Juan Story stuck with his commitment to Florida
- Aundrey Walker of Glenville spurned OSU for USC
- Darius Jennings picks UVA. Looks like he wanted to play offense and stay close to home.
- Shane Wynn is an Indiana Hoosier! If OSU had offered he'd be in, but nice get for Kevin Wilson.
- Glenville LB Andre Sturdivant signed with Toledo.
- Toledo Rogers (DerJuan Gambrell) has announced they are postponing signing day festivities until tomorrow at 9am.
- Chris Carter was arrested today on accusations he fondled girls at his school. Obviously, we will not see a NLI from him today and you have to wonder if he'll ever make it to Ohio State.
